I was just having a little fun at Ethan's expense when I made the post this morning..
One thing he stated that did give me pause was when he said "they didn't have their phones". I am assuming they have become some what cell phone dependent for navigation?
I recall back in the days after I found my GPS to be a dependable navigation aid I'd just punch in my waypoints and away I'd go. It didn't take long before I'd stopped taking notice of the basic physical landmarks and such that I'd normally always mentally logged when traveling into new areas.
Maybe something similar goin' on there?
